Output c77b63c588b334d1884004385a9e69053f5650312f95b1f9bd7eba71423ef5a3:0

value
187630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198aea65577a3d878aef98345874dbbdc8820501 OP_EQUAL
address
3425EN8tACBKfXv1JyJG3wGiGrXgKrdgqG
transaction
c77b63c588b334d1884004385a9e69053f5650312f95b1f9bd7eba71423ef5a3
spent
true